Biographical Information[edit]

Catcher Harry Bemis was with the deadball era Cleveland Naps, in the formative year of the American League, for nine years. He was a teammate of Hall of Famers Nap Lajoie and Elmer Flick. He made his major league debut at age 28 and was still playing catcher in 1910 as one of the oldest players in the American League. His 1947 New York Times obituary said he was nicknamed "Handsome Harry", and (wrongly) stated he had played with the Boston National League team before coming to Cleveland. It also said he started with Toronto in 1898 (when he would have already been 24) and later played for Columbus, Toronto, Memphis and Newark.
